Meet Harlow

Breed: Staffy Cross Doberman

Barking from: Auckland

What's up dog?

Woof, my name is Harlow. I am an office dog at Rentokil Initial in Auckland city. I'm not your average office dog, I am a BIG one. Im 47 kgs and still tries to sit on my mum's lap while she's working. I am a Staffy and Doberman cross hence my staffy face and Doberman chest. I am a 2 year old boy who is full of love and affection to all my work colleagues and enjoys working alongside them. I love the attention I get when I arrive, everyone's frown turns upside down. The day goes from office day to Harlow day! I am a very well behaved boy when I'm visiting the office, I sit beside my mum and her colleagues entertaining myself. I will sleep, play with toys, solve my puzzles or enjoy a massage from the ladies with long nails. I am an independent and a calm boy which allows mum to get her work done efficiently. I am well socialised in the office environment and enjoy every moment. I even get invited to the work meetings hehe. My favourite part of the office days is showing off my tricks and getting treats for my obedience. I enjoy showing off my loud deep woofs, playing dead, and shaking multiple people's hands. I am the most excellent guard dog and even started protecting the workplace from contractors maintaining the building, I guess the office is my second home. I have become a mascot at Rentokil and well known for my loyalty, obedience, friendliness, confidence and calm presence. I even have my own Rentokil Initial bandana I wear when I visit. This is what one of my colleagues said about me"Harlow is a beloved addition to our team on our company Bring Your Dog To Work days. He is popular amongst the office for being friendly and well-behaved. Even with my fear of dogs, I am comfortable in his presence and look forward to his visits. Harlow is the fur-baby to Tina, who has done an exceptional job training and socialising him. " - Zana. I'm so glad that I am able to help my colleagues try to overcome their fears and make their days better. It makes me a happy boy that I am able to change the negative perceptions about bull breeds/Dobermans. Please think about judging us before you assume. We have suffered the most due to stereotypes, it's not our true nature but how we are raised. My mum wouldn't want me any other way.
